With over 25 years’ experience in the industry, we understand the vital role vertical transportation plays in a successful built environment.

We provide independent expert advice and foster a collaborative, problem solving approach, working closely with clients and stakeholders to identify their specific requirements which enables us to provide innovative, reliable, efficient, compliant, and cost-effective solutions to their vertical transportation needs.

Whether new build, extension, refurbishment or portfolio management, we offer a range of services including surveys and reports, feasibility, technical design, project support through the construction, commissioning, handover and in use stages.

Our knowledge and experience can be applied across all sectors including commercial offices, residential, retail, healthcare, industrial, logistics and distribution to identify the most environmentally sustainable solution thorough the application of the latest technologies to minimise the environmental impact of works and help our clients achieve their carbon reduction goals.

Our vertical transportation services team collaborate with colleagues in our mechanical, electrical, structural and energy sectors ensuring a holistic approach and that clients benefit from Rolton’s wider expertise to deliver the complete solution to their needs.

Our vertical transportation team typically offers the following services:

  • Condition, life cycle, acquisition, dilapidation, survey & reporting
  • Energy efficiency & compliance assessment
  • Financial planning
  • CDM
  • Design & specification
  • Tender, tender evaluation
  • Project management including quality & cost management
  • Test & commissioning oversight
  • Technical submittal & documentation review
  • Asset management
  • Remote & live monitoring

We also offer maintenance management support services including:

  • Appraisal of existing maintenance agreements
  • Maintenance specifications & agreements inc’ SLA’s & KPI’s
  • Regular contractor performance review & monitoring meetings
  • Maintenance audits
  • Reliability improvements
  • Financial review, planning & assessment of contractor invoicing
  • Statutory compliance monitoring (LOLER & PUWER)
